As part of our larger study, we validated our predicted methylated and hydroxymethylated binding preferences of OCT4. This represents the first conjoint CUT&RUN experiment across conventional, methylation-, and hydroxymethylation-enriched sequences. Overall design: We employed cleavage under targets and release using nuclease (CUT&RUN), across an aggregated OCT4 sample, with two replicates, which was then sequenced via 3 different strategies. We also included a single IgG control.
